温馨提示×

plsql怎么导出用户下所有表及数据

小亿
136
2024-01-16 19:34:48
栏目: 云计算

要导出一个用户下的所有表及数据,可以使用PL/SQL的数据泵导出工具,如expdp命令。以下是一个例子:

  1. 打开命令行界面,并登录到数据库。
  2. 运行以下命令导出用户下的所有表及数据:
expdp username/password@database_name schemas=your_user_name directory=your_directory dumpfile=your_dump_file.dmp logfile=your_log_file.log

其中,username/password@database_name是连接到数据库的用户名、密码和数据库名;your_user_name是要导出的用户名称;your_directory是一个已经创建的目录对象,用于指定导出文件的存储位置;your_dump_file.dmp是导出的数据文件名;your_log_file.log是导出的日志文件名。

运行该命令后,数据泵工具将会导出指定用户下的所有表及数据,并将结果存储在指定的导出文件中。

注意:在运行命令之前,请确保已经正确设置了数据库的环境变量,以便能够找到expdp命令。

0